Content Editor (PIM)
A role responsible for creating, enriching, and reviewing product content within a PIM system to ensure accuracy and brand consistency.
What is Content Editor (PIM)? (Definition)
A Content Editor (PIM) is a person or team that manages product information in a PIM system. They write and review product descriptions, marketing text, and technical details. This work ensures that every product has accurate data for webshops and marketplaces. These editors also manage translations and keep the brand voice consistent. Examples of Content Editor (PIM)
- 1A content editor writes clear product descriptions for a clothing store to explain how items look and fit.
- 2They update product titles and bullet points with search terms to help customers find items on marketplaces like Amazon.
- 3They translate product details into different languages to help a brand sell products in other countries.
- 4A content editor reviews and approves customer feedback before it appears on the website.
- 5They make sure all text follows brand rules and includes necessary legal warnings.
